The dam Pego do Altar ( Portuguese Barragem do Pego do Altar ) is located in the Alentejo region of Portugal in the Setúbal district . It dams the Alcáçovas , a right (eastern) tributary of the Sado to a reservoir (Port. Albufeira da Barragem do Pego do Altar ). The town of Alcácer do Sal is about eight kilometers southwest of the dam.
The project to build the dam began in 1934. The construction was completed in 1949. In addition to irrigation, the dam is also used to generate electricity. It is owned by the Associação de Beneficiários do Vale do Sado .
Barrier structure
The barrier structure is a CFR dam with a height of 63 m above the foundation level (43.5 m above the river bed). The top of the dam is at a height of 56 m above sea level . The length of the dam crest is 192 m and its width 5 m. The volume of the structure is 371,000 m³.
The dam has both a bottom outlet and a flood relief . A maximum of 80 m³ / s can be discharged via the bottom outlet, and a maximum of 1,200 m³ / s via the flood discharge. The design flood is 2,120 m³ / s; the probability of this event occurring has been determined to be once in 10,000 years.
Reservoir
With a normal storage target of 52.26 m (maximum 52.26 m at high water), the reservoir extends over an area of around 6.55 km² and holds 94 million m³ of water - of which 93.6 million m³ can be used. The minimum congestion destination is 15 m.
power plant
With an installed capacity of 2 MW , the Pego do Altar power plant is one of the smallest hydropower plants in Portugal. The average standard energy capacity is 3 (or 5.2) million kWh per year.
The Francis turbine was supplied by VA Tech Escher Wyss . It is located in a machine house at the foot of the dam. The power plant's turbine has a maximum output of 2 MW and the associated generator 2.45 MVA . The rated speed of the turbine is 500 rpm. The nominal voltage of the generator is 6 kV . In the switchgear , the generator voltage of 6 kV is increased to 30 kV by means of a power transformer.
The minimum height of fall is 6.22 m, the maximum 43.48 m. The minimum flow is 2 m³ / s, the maximum is 6 m³ / s.
